Advantages and Risks of Online Shopping

Online shopping lets you purchase goods or services from a retailer that isn't located in your region. It can be more convenient and less expensive than going to a brick-and-mortar shop. It is also safer.

Marketplaces online like Etsy provide hand-crafted or artisanal items. Others are niche such as Avito which caters to the European market.

Online stores carry a wide variety of products

The wide range of merchandise accessible online is a major benefit. As opposed to brick-and-mortar stores retailers aren't restricted by the size of their stores or inventory. Many online stores offer competitive prices as well as a broad range of product options. Online shoppers can also compare prices with ease by using price comparison websites and browser extensions. In addition, many online stores provide helpful information such as specs for models and customer reviews.

Online shoppers can save lots of time by not having to visit the physical store. Online shoppers can shop from anywhere in the globe, and find items that may not be available locally. They also can avoid the hassle of locating a parking space and navigating crowds. Online shopping is convenient, especially for busy people.

Online shopping has numerous advantages, however some customers are still concerned about the quality of their purchases. Consumers who receive faulty or defective items may have to contact the retailer, pay for return shipping and wait for a replacement or refund. This can be a frustrating process and stressful for customers in some situations. Fortunately, some online companies offer more flexible return policies than traditional retailers.

The lack of face-to-face interaction with salespersons is another problem when purchasing products on the internet. Some customers might find this to be a problem particularly when buying clothes and shoes. However, some online stores have begun to solve this issue by offering options like virtual fitting rooms and 360-degree images of the products. Furthermore, many online stores let customers make a call or live chat with a salesperson.

In the beginning of e-commerce, the majority sales were for products that didn't require examination. This enabled online shopping to expand into many categories, including appliances and furniture. Today, the market for online shopping is estimated to be worth billions of dollars.

Convenience is the most important factor in this rapid growth. While traditional retail stores are open during business hours, most uk online shopping shops are available 24 hours a day. They can also be accessed via any device with an Internet connection, even mobile devices.

It is more convenient

Shopping online is a convenient and efficient method of purchasing products. Online shops are accessible all day, 7 days a week, unlike physical stores which are only open during specific hours. You can shop in the comfort of your workplace or at your home. Furthermore online shopping provides a wide range of payment options and delivery methods. This convenience is one of the main reasons behind the recent boom in the e-commerce.

Shopping online offers the benefit of comparison of prices and product information without leaving your home. Many retailers offer price comparisons and reviews from customers to aid you in making an informed decision about your purchase. You can also find out about the latest discounts and promotions that aren't always readily accessible in physical stores. In addition, some retailers send you product reminder emails if you leave items in your cart. This feature is especially beneficial for consumers who are looking to save money and track their purchases.

Online shopping is convenient for those with hectic schedules or mobility issues. It eliminates the need for consumers to travel to physical shops or parking lots, then stand in line for checkout counters. It also allows shoppers to spend their time and energy to other activities or leisure activities.

Aside from convenience in online shopping, it's an excellent choice for products that are similar in nature, like toilet paper and printer ink. These items can be purchased in large quantities, which can save money and time in shipping. Many online retailers allow you to return items that is not exactly what you were expecting. This lets you purchase with confidence.

As compared to traditional brick-and mortar stores, online shopping is also more affordable and convenient. You can save on gas and parking fees as well as avoid the expense of food and beverages in the store. Furthermore, you can use your credit or debit card to make the transaction instead of carrying around cash. You can shop at your home or at the office even if you are on vacation or working late.

The online retail industry has made huge advancements in ensuring that customers' personal and financial information is safe. Secure socket layer (SSL) is an encryption technology, is used by most online retail sites to safeguard your personal information. Additionally, certain online stores are backed by reputable financial institutions in order to ensure that customers are safe from identity theft and fraud.

They can be less expensive

Online shopping can be cheaper than purchasing the same product in a brick-and-mortar store. It is cheaper for retailers to ship their products directly from a warehouse to their customers than to display the items in stores. Many retailers offer lower prices due to the fact that they don't have to pay for retail space and sales staff. Some retailers also offer coupons and discounts in order online to attract shoppers.

However it is crucial to be aware that the cost of certain products can vary based on your location or browser history and your operating system. This is a typical aspect of online shopping. Some retailers may also employ dynamic pricing strategies, which can increase or decrease the price based on seasonality, demand and market conditions. Online shoppers should track prices to find the best deals.

Online shopping lets shoppers avoid long lines and crowds at stores. This is particularly true during pandemics, when it can be difficult to navigate the packed aisles and queues for checkouts. Additionally, online stores generally have faster delivery times than traditional stores. Many online retailers allow customers to return items within a certain time frame which is helpful if the product ordered is defective or the purchase was made in error.

Online shopping is also cheaper for items with little variation, like printer toner, windshield liquid, and toilet paper. It is also possible to purchase a wide selection of items, including those that are not readily available in local grocery shops. Additionally, many websites have reviews by customers which can help in making informed buying choices.

Online shopping is becoming more popular due to the speedy shipping times and lower costs. There are some who are still cautious about the process. Despite the numerous advantages, there are a few drawbacks to online shopping that include the risk of fraud and identity theft. There are ways to safeguard yourself from these dangers. For example, you can use a VPN, or browse privately. Additionally, it's a good idea to read the conditions of service and return policies carefully prior to making any purchases.

They are more secure.

Online shopping has many advantages, such as the ability for consumers to save time, avoid the hassles of going to stores and waiting in lines, and navigate through the crowded aisles. However, it is important to be aware of the risks associated with online shopping to protect your personal information and finances. Certain online retailers like Amazon.com, Walmart.com, and eBay have strict security measures in place to protect against identity theft. However, other retailers may be less careful and make customers vulnerable to fraud.

Utilizing a virtual private network (VPN) is among the best ways to shop securely. This will ensure that no one will be able to access your personal information or alter your computer while you're online. It's also best Online shop to shop on secure Wi-Fi networks. The public Wi-Fi networks at hotels, airports and cafes are more prone to be hacked, so it's recommended to avoid them all together.

Make use of credit cards instead of a debit card for online purchases. Credit cards are tied to your bank account, which makes them more difficult to hack, and offer additional protection in case you become a victim of fraud. You should also choose an account password that is two-factor authentication to ensure your information is secure. Avoid passwords that include dictionary words or personal information that could be easily guessed by thieves, such as your birthday, your child's name, or your favorite sports team.

Check the website address of the seller to confirm it begins with https. This means that the website utilizes SSL encryption to protect the shared data, thereby protecting your sensitive information. Also, make sure that your browser is set to block pop-ups, and don't open files or click on links within emails from unknown senders.
